What is a lip model?

A Lip Model is a professional who specializes in showcasing their lips for commercials, advertisements, beauty products, and other forms of visual media. They are often hired for lipstick, skincare, or dental campaigns, where close-up shots of their lips are the main focus. Maintaining smooth, well-groomed lips is essential for success in this role. Lip models may work with brands, photographers, and cosmetic companies to create high-quality images and videos.

What is a typical workday like for a lip model?

A typical workday for a Lip Model often involves attending scheduled photo or video shoots, collaborating with photographers, stylists, and makeup artists to achieve the desired look for beauty campaigns or product advertisements. You may spend time in makeup, participate in product application demonstrations, and pose for close-up shots focused specifically on your lips. Flexibility is important, as shoots can vary in length and setting, and you may need to be available on short notice depending on client needs. Lip Models often work as freelancers and may handle their own scheduling, promotion, and client communications. Building strong professional relationships and maintaining your appearance are ongoing responsibilities that help advance your career.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a lip model?

To excel as a Lip Model, you typically need well-groomed, symmetrical lips, clear skin around the mouth, and experience or comfort in front of a camera. Familiarity with photo and video shoots, as well as the ability to follow direction from photographers or makeup artists, is often required. Professionalism, punctuality, and the ability to maintain a positive attitude during long sessions are key soft skills. These qualities are important because they ensure high-quality results for clients and help build a strong reputation in a competitive industry.

How do you become a lip model?

To become a lip model, individuals typically build a portfolio showcasing their lips and facial features, often through professional photos or by working with photographers. Success in the field also depends on having clear, healthy lips, good skin, and the ability to pose for makeup or skincare brands; some models may also need to attend casting calls or work with modeling agencies specializing in beauty or skincare. Maintaining good skincare and lip health is essential for consistent work in this niche.

How much do lip models get paid?

Lip models typically earn between $50 and $200 per hour, depending on experience, the scope of the project, and the location. Payment can also be structured as flat rates for specific campaigns or photoshoots, with some models earning additional compensation for usage rights or exclusivity.
